A new three-dimensional metal-organic framework {[Zn(mpda)(0.5)(bix)]center dot(H(2)O)(1.5)}(n) (1) (H(4)mpda = 1,2,3,4-benzenetetracarboxylic acid, m-bix = 1,3-bis(imidazol-1-ylmethyl)-benzene) has been synthesized and characterized by single-crystal X-ray diffraction and IR spectra. In 1, homochiral helical chains are formed in the Zn-mpda layer through spontaneous resolution by mpda(4-). Such layers are further connected through the second m-bix ligand to form a 3D chiral metal-organic framework. The individual (4,4)-connected net in 1 can be specified by the Schlafli symbol (6(6))(2)(6(4).8(2)). Bulk material of 1 has good second-harmonic generation (SHG) activity, approximately 0.4 times that of urea. In addition, a thermogravimetric analysis was carried out, and the photoluminescent behavior of the complex was also investigated.
